| noon: 3 (21:46) NIST, shakeout pm: Washington-Lee H.S. track Well, some days you are better off staying in bed... especially if your room is air conditioned! I was not mentally up for the humidity tonight... So, tonight was the first workout in awhile that I was not thoroughly happy with. I just lost concentration and did not finish strong. I have excuses readily available, but the truth is that for some reason I was mentally out of it. I am not totally disappointed because I still managed to hit my target average pace. The workout was 3 x 1 mi with 400 rest. I did an abbreviated version of drills (I am still working up to the full list), which amounted to about 9 sets. I hit the miles in 4:52.2, 4:57.6, 5:00.5. Ave = 4:56.8. I was hoping to ave 4:56 (15:20 5k pace) and with the short rest and given that it was hot and disgustingly humid, I guess I can take some positives from that. I just wanted to do it in a much more controlled and evenly-paced way. But the first one felt so easy that I just thought I was on my way to a breakthrough workout. Then I just did not want to push. I mean, I should have been able to just hit 73 for the first quarter in the last rep and then hang on. Ya know, just focus... 36.5 per 200. Instead I go 76,75,75,74. I guess the reality is that the first mile was too fast and I just never recovered. But still, I do not remember hurting at all in the workout. And that was sort of the aim of this workout, with the short rest, to make myself hurt. But I could not do it. I am looking forward to resting and a couple of sharpening workouts this weekend and next week. I think I am ready for the 5k... I just need to not do anything stupid. Another positive I can take from this workout is that my bruised foot did not bother me in spikes. That could have been trouble.

| Landon H.S. track
2 x (800, 400, 200) with equal rest after 8s and 4s and 600 after the 2... i.e., full recovery, the purpose being just speed work. Did the workout in spikes.
2:17.9, 65.4, 30.5 2:18.3, 65.5, 30.3 Well, that's about as consistent as I can be, I think. Given my mileage this week (94) I am pretty happy with this workout. I think my speed is where it needs to be. With some rest this week, I think I'll be ready to go next Saturday.
